摘要
As Codesign problems become larger and more realistic, the required time to estimate their solutions turns into an important bottleneck. This paper presents a new approach to improve the traditional estimation techniques, in order to avoid this drawback. The presented method has been successfully tested on a large experimental benchmark, attaining quality levels close to those provided by the Synopsys Behavioral Compiler. Finally, a case study based on the standard H.261 video co-dec is described, proving the convenience of the technique on real-life situations. The obtained results show a significant improvement in the process time, while keeping the good precision and fidelity levels that the traditional estimation models usually offer.
